Visual Basic para Aplicaciones - Limitar el numero de checkboes activados

Life is soft - evento anual de software empresarial
 
Vista:

Limitar el numero de checkboes activados

Publicado por Marina (1 intervención) el 24/11/2005 16:42:25
Hola a todos!

Tengo un pequenho problema o duda. A ver, tengo una serie de checkboxes en un formulario.

La cuestion es que quiero que solo se puedan seleccionar 3 y al 4, te salga un Msgbox que te ponga algo asi como: "Ni uno mas".

He creado una variable publica cont as integer, porque no sabia en que procedimiento utilizarla exactamente, y la voy a usar de contador... pero de ahi, no se seguir.

No se ni en que metodo utilizarlo ni nada... alguien me puede AYUDAR, POR FA?

ASIAS DE ANTEMANO,

Marina.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Limitar el numero de checkboes activados

Publicado por carlos (55 intervenciones) el 29/11/2005 15:21:51
Proba con este codigo:

Private Sub CommandButton1_Click()
Dim CheckBox As Control
Dim i As Integer

i = 0

For Each CheckBox In Controls
If CheckBox.Value = True Then
i = i + 1
End If
Next CheckBox

If i > 3 Then MsgBox " XXXX ", vbExclamation

End Sub

Suerte !!!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Limitar el numero de checkboes activados

Publicado por Dominic (1 intervención) el 15/11/2016 02:04:59
Estoy en las mismas y probe el codigo

Me dice que 'Value' no es un miembro de Control
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ar